  • Collier County is renourishing Vanderbilt Beach with 4,500 tons of sand to restore coastlines damaged by hurricanes—using trucks from Immokalee today—while beachgoers must seek alternative access as crews work to finish before July 4 and check for sea turtle nests.  ABC7

  • Lee Health received ACGME approval to launch a four-year OB/GYN residency at Cape Coral Hospital in collaboration with Florida State University College of Medicine. The program will begin in July 2026 with six residents and add six each year until reaching 24—Dr. Carrie Johnson will serve as program director.  Naples Daily News
  • Beesley’s Paw Prints Pet Therapy Program is expanding its outreach by launching Beesley’s Gentle Paws Response — a new initiative that will send 85 certified therapy dogs to help families during tragedies such as hurricanes or serious accidents. The program partners with the Children's Advocacy Center and United Way and will have dogs visit schools, hospitals, and VA clinics when needed.  WINK News
